oracle 左连接查询
时间: 2023-08-19 17:13:03 浏览: 93
SQL左连接查询[整理].pdf
在Oracle中,左连接查询是通过使用LEFT JOIN关键字来实现的。左连接查询可以返回左表中的所有记录,以及与右表中匹配的记录。如果右表中没有匹配的记录,那么对应的列将会显示为NULL。
下面是一个示例,展示了如何在Oracle中进行左连接查询:
```
SELECT *
FROM tab_L
LEFT JOIN tab_R ON tab_L.test_L = tab_R.test_R;
```
在这个示例中,我们使用了tab_L和tab_R两个表进行左连接查询。通过将tab_L.test_L与tab_R.test_R进行关联,我们可以获取左表中的所有记录,并且如果右表中有匹配的记录,那么就会将其添加到结果中。
请注意,左连接查询可能会导致结果中出现重复的数据。如果你想消除重复的数据,可以使用GROUP BY子句或DISTINCT关键字来实现。具体的方法可以根据你的需求和数据结构来选择。
希望这个回答对你有帮助![1][2]
阅读全文